JYP, LIVE NATION ALIGN FOR TOURS

JYP Entertainment has struck a partnership with Live Nation to produce tours for artists on the K-pop label's roster, which includes TWICE and Stray Kids.

The partnership formalizes and expands the existing relationship between the two companies which have produced tours together over the last several years. Live Nation produced TWICE’s stadium shows in the U.S. and is behind their current 44 show/25 city global tour; they also produced Stray Kids’ 42 shows in 18 cities across North America and Asia.

JYP Entertainment’s most recent strategic partnership was struck with Republic Records in June and continues to bear fruit with Stray Kids’ impressive chart performance.
